ABSTRACT

Population parameters of 1630 specimens of Heteropneustes fossilis were estimated from length-frequency data, collected from the fish market of Laksham, Cumilla from November, 2019 to October, 2020. For the purpose of estimating the parameters FAO-ICLARM Stock Assessment Tool (FiSAT II) software was used. Asymptotic length (L) and growth coefficient (K) of this fish were estimated to be 28.88 cm and 0.70/year, respectively. Instantaneous rate of natural mortality (M), fishing mortality (F) and total mortality (Z) were estimated to be 1.43, 0.34 and 1.77, respectively. Recruitment pattern of the species was short with one peak, during May to August. The L25, L50 and L75 were found to be 20.78 cm, 23.51 cm and 24.81 cm, respectively. Relative yield per recruit (Yʹ/R) and biomass per recruit (Bʹ/R) were 0.655 and 2.042, respectively. Value of exploitation (E) was found to be 0.19 which indicated that H. fossilis was not over fished (E > 0.50) in the study area. Maximum exploitation (Emax) value was 0.55. It indicates that more fish can be harvested.        .
